货物的刚性调节了细胞形成. 硬颗粒会触发正常的吞,而软颗粒会引起明显的细胞反应,突出显示整合素信号传递.

背景情况:
- 消化细胞是一种关键的细胞过程,涉及颗粒的吞.
- 细胞和货物的机械特性都影响着细胞形成.
- 了解货物的刚性如何影响巨细胞化是必不可少的.
研究的目的:
- 调查货物刚性的作用,以调节巨细胞体的细胞化.
- 阐明了机械调节的细胞形成的细胞和分子机制.
主要方法:
- 利用不同可变形的水凝微粒来模拟不同的货物刚度.
- 采用蛋白组学来识别关键的信号分子.
- 生成的巨细胞缺乏特定的蛋白质 (β2整合素,Talin1,Vinculin) 来评估它们的功能.
主要成果:
- 刚性货物诱导了正规的细胞杯形成和快速吞.
- 软货物导致了不同的反应:中心的突出,更慢的杯子进步和细胞停滞.
- 确定β2整合素是这种机械开关的关键介质.
- 缺乏β2整合素或下游效应因子的巨体在细胞杯架构和选择性刚性载荷吸收方面表现出缺陷.
结论:
- 集成蛋白信号传递作为细胞分裂中的机械检查点.
- 这一检查点确保根据货物的刚性进行适当的吞.
- 巨细胞化是由目标粒子的机械性质细微调整的.
